Which GRE do I need to take to get into a graduate English Language Literature program?
Jan K - 2007-04-13 14:14:50 - Higher Education (University +)
I know I need the subject test. Do I also need to take a general exam?
Best Answer:
Yes, you have to take both the GRE-general and the GRE-Lit exams. All of the half-decent programs require the GRE Lit, and all programs require the GRE general. Check out each individual program's application requirements for the specifics on this... and good friggin luck! start studying right now if you plan on taking the lit test next fall. you'll need that time to prep. it is MUCH harder than the general GRE. go to a bookstore and get a practice exam, like now -- take it, sit through the entire thing in a closed environment, and score yourself. figure out where you go wrong and work on that for the next six months. take a hundred practice exams. it will definitely help. and again, GOOD LUCK.
